Remember back in 2021, when curbside pickup at a department store (other than Sears, which was way ahead of the curve on these things) was so novel that it was worth taking a picture of? It's hard to remember now that this is so ubiquitous at every kind of store, and I almost skipped this picture as a result, but it's an interesting reminder of how quickly things can change, and just like the drive-through testing facility on the other side of the mall, it captures the specific feel of the early post-pandemic years. Heck, according to the sign in the previous picture, you could even order food from the Nordstrom restaurant for curbside pickup -- I can't imagine they're doing that any longer!
